.payment {
    padding: 87px 136px;
}
.payment__bg {
    background: #f2deff;
    border-radius: 20px;
    box-shadow: 0 4px 4px rgba(0, 0, 0, 0.25);
}
.payment__title {
    /*text-align: center;*/
}
.payment__title span {
    min-height: 72px;
    /*font-family: Inter;*/
    font-weight: 400;
    font-size: 36px;
    line-height: 1.22;
    color: #000000;
    padding-left: 96px;
    margin-bottom: 73px;
    background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AEgAAABICAYAAABV7bNHAAAACXBIWXMAAAsTAAALEwEAmpwYAAAAAXNSR0IArs4c6QAAAARnQU1BAACxjwv8YQUAAAj/SURBVHgB7ZtLbFxnFcf/333N0/bYGcc2dmI7SZMmTZU2CTRCKS8VWglYwCKlKAuKUoSEKOoCFoVFNkjsWEDYpLBgAw2CbhAUpSpFDYnUtHm0qZPmZccZx56MZ8Yez3vuo+dc2xN7xs44M+PaN7o/aeTxnTuP+5/v+845//MN4OLi4uLi4vKQIioPHBs40S2rpe2yJO+FZYXgQCyBCSFw5aUrL7yDBikLdAIn5NgAOjW/dUgY1uOWJfpIIC+ciECaLmwShvk6oFw/cuPQddSJUr63C7JmikclE89LmrQfstB87RqchlEyUcro0HMGDSXZNIXxz6NfOTpy9J2jOuqgLNC0pLfLkvJzs2Tt8Hf5ta59YXz5N0/BaaRG0xj+921cPH4ZxZnSD4UlUr2RbWfpoQjqQJq/o/gUoXiVsL/Hp/V8oRN7frQTTiTQ5UPPgY3lz09rUVBWlY2ok7JAXs0jCVl4tKAmAj0BhLa0wonIHtkWqWN72/whhSZb3WuFVHlA8Uq0GElwMkKRoPgVNANnK/EZUCVzLpbDndNRGAUDTqWUNZBP5u2ZYFkUzEwT9VIlUCZWQHo8irEzUTgdrUWFZVgwC00UyN/pQWigBV37OuFUSlmdRlAB194Ymc2EZdRNlUCeNhLokTYMPNMLp5JLFpEey9gCNUqVQDxv/Z0UJne2w6lkJ/OQFIFm4EaxGrgC1aBqiulU6M1E0oi8Ow6nUpguIhvNrU6YL84UMXE2hunhGTgVU7dgFE2oAQrzuolCtokCsU0gaQ3ExfWAadnCcKhvepj3bfSha28Yg8/2wanwFMtM5BC/MoVGqRJIDSho3RxE39M9cCoc5qdvptAM3ChWA1egGrgC1cAVqAYN2W7sGRlkJVx9YxiTQwlk7mSxHjApB9Lzs34W5YnPwcCe4zv+cv9V27ROGSZO/fjG999ceLghgZLXphH7KGFn3ZxzmNRy8bStfauIvHXypiUEe/1k2ougkEQ3JUTLVt8zt9LUbBRCktF6fNtfp3K4e/7l6y8X+LG6BbIoW41/nJwdPR8l4aUeWqDHD394/fQaW3oD/Cc4d1uWYqrECfKAntcHoYoYSh1DdLgxgbLxPBI3UohdTNjO3WM/2IEtz25Ca38QTuPqP4bxyd9uIno+HlY0+bCqiT/RYXtK1i0QTyk9O9us5B5U38Fuu93iRPq+1IN8gsoSRXii78f71IJc1qVugXiBNvXZIpB7UN4OD2Tv2tdwXGbwF1dMl2CSHy1TC0hSJfvzqT6FRah6Di8L9vKwwSdR5e8XC4q3pjSPuAfFvaj1QOxiHHc/TCA+lLSdCR9dfOumIHpphG/YGaLlYOkgolDDUfZWX0OVQKWcXg6RTsGgz5um4vTMr8/ZNo1B16CQ1RHo8iJ+OYnb/xvH1b8Po/+ZPnTvD2Prt/tX/NplgWgFtyyBTCFRMBKfTGHkrQgZ986o6Cfej/ECa48aLrTbqG3eQY0HrVVFIcltrBwip8YRuxS3B0BoWyvat7XZU68WZYHkgmIWVT1TSBfM5NVp3HprzDkCfRDD8H8iyFEVP0iRtP9rn7OnFMNrJVsf6TsZRM9N2i2h+OUptPW3PJhAillIptP4haSK35Pl+vnUaFprRttkteEvcuJc3BbnwKtP2j5WoNtffpw3M3Dq8fU/HMTbr5zB3QtxnPvdx+j9YteK+vf3zhiCke7DaFDGb2VT7KV+5CClof5ln2lZHTQn+4XAZqwhPDL0bMkeDd3U7GSbdTl4keb0hEVir3ollAU6hEMGIki8tuu1/1p66CYVJ1slYS2b9VGA3yIJ8VUyN9dUIA7rXOLIJFBoS4s9YpbDDufdPsqadduSZZFEjfZZ1Rg7MnQkQX/4dv5+T6Sa5QCEtYnuHsR6QBIPtOWllKE8rmjcV1D7ZeFw/F1+O0E18jrGTkUp91l+K2KCgk+KClO2ldWgSs2J2pfveIFaNwfgoeSPp1nk/+Nza9JikTiSJSgfmuHHSEhOARSfxJV+zdd3vEDhXR3wb/Ta6wkXnJPkMOSniovOYYFGKNpNXkrQmlWyUwB5ha2t5uxTW0M4GXzyJ7sx+NxmCuOn8e6v3iPBfCRcu213TFF3I3EtRZ3WLFooieQNqnt/unvFr+94gRhPSLMj2L6f7cbY6ShysTxNtSxSIzN2jRikyLXp6W7w1uY5j2jFPBQCqRS9OBoNfGOT/duByUtJEieDbKoAPyWNocEW6vORQPs7H9jQeygEYiSyWdmPeuzwdjQTt6tRg1UZQexX65SEVYZbRqP8g9eF+R1gFqXkZsngnw1Uncv5Dfs080UlG2B2J4XsDctcXCuwUe9t9yw6xoUph3++VeINeZY0zypZFYHYT8ol88iMV7eBWje30KJKSZoy+9YsTimt29GmEja7/GEftDmB5ndsZKk6N43FF81rUKVAfG4xVVxS/I17NpDbWDvUr4pAyRtkl5yM4OLxK1WPHXj1CXtjxPxPHXijAbuAXGlX8sh3BrD9u4MUmmd/asEV+zUy2C/9+ardiVhIkKLT997+1qJjfO74e3fpFqt67efp3JVEtFURiL/J8O4O+wIrCW1tW2R7cgTii1vqXK7OfQuiDtdaHVSRb/1mv50RV75nJXwuj6zgEkJoK6zbVkUgDqXynrBthFcSpGOelnuWhEb2BE+7nS9sqzqXL9rXcU8gXr86H99AeY3fXo8WslTRyee2DbSg56nqH/soaykQvznfAj2120BcMHo1jcTYUPtcWos4lK+0vfQg5y77nnC5L65ANXAFqkFTBBp+8zYy5LU4Fc7D2CaZpLZRJQ0s0nqEsr2EsERx4oNJzUOt3SK9kRM3L9w6OYbohUnefJ4TEiIl1SjnEHUL9NL1w5E/Pvp6nMZgKXFlSuN8hksASXHe7ljewsNZfyFVzJH5fy0gKeUstLEdZob+L5qld2RVPha9ENeoMad8uET27ASoNpxSFHG2VMAvg6pe3mDdkEDpnDrq8SAtm3iF/g0Ly3LmT6UJYUm3ZFm6lcyZoyefgIGhueNoAsc6TwQ9reg2JThvAZpDLWVGXhx5sfGt+S4uLi5N5FOOGn3U+2OuPAAAAABJRU5ErkJggg==) no-repeat left center;
    display: -ms-inline-flexbox;
    display: inline-flex;
    -ms-flex-align: center;
    -webkit-box-align: center;
    align-items: center;
    margin-left: auto;
    margin-right: auto;
}
.payment__div {
    width: 100%;
    max-width: 800px;
    background: #ffffff;
    border-radius: 20px;
    margin-left: auto;
    margin-right: auto;
    padding: 70px 139px;
}
.payment__btn {
    min-height: 90px;
    width: 100%;
    color: #fff;
    background: #f25146;
    font-weight: 500;
    font-size: 30px;
    line-height: 1;
    cursor: pointer;
}

.form-group {
    margin-bottom: 48px;
}
.form-group label {
    display: inline-block;
    max-width: 100%;
    margin-bottom: 14px;
    /*font-family: Inter;*/
    font-style: normal;
    font-weight: bold;
    font-weight: 300;
    font-size: 32px;
    line-height: 1;
    color: #000000;
}
.form-control {
    min-height: 90px;
    width: 100%;
    border: 0;
    outline: 0;
    padding: 30px 28px;
    color: #000000;

    background: #ffffff;
    border: 1px solid #b7b7b7;
    border-radius: 10px;
    box-shadow: 0px 4px 2px rgba(0, 0, 0, 0.1);

    font-weight: 300;
    font-size: 30px;
    line-height: 1;
}

.btn {
    width: 100%;
    min-height: 90px;
    font-weight: 500;
    font-size: 30px;
    line-height: 1;
    background: rgba(240,50,38,.85);
    border-color: rgba(240,50,38,.85);
    color: #fff;
    padding: 0 30px;
    display: inline-block;
    position: relative;
    margin: 0;
    cursor: pointer;
    outline: 0;
    text-align: center;
    white-space: nowrap;
    transition-duration: .2s;
    transition-property: background,border-color,color,width;
    transition-timing-function: ease;
    border-radius: 3px;
}
.btn:hover {
    background: #f03226;
    border-color: #f03226;
}

@media (max-width: 768px) {
    .payment {
        padding: 20px;
    }
    .payment__title span {
        min-height: 44px;
        font-size: 14px;
        background-size: 40px;
        padding-left: 50px;
        margin-bottom: 20px;
    }
    .payment__div {
        padding: 20px;
    }
    .form-group {
        margin-bottom: 20px;
    }
    .form-group label {
        font-size: 16px;
        margin-bottom: 8px;
    }
    .form-control {
        min-height: 50px;
        padding: 12px 14px;
        font-size: 18px;
    }
    .btn {
        min-height: 50px;
        font-size: 18px;
    }
}